Get Substring from given string Getting all the variations of a string with a given length In this article we will discuss how to replace all occurrences of a sub string with new string in C++. Java program to find and display all substrings This program find all substrings of a string and the prints them. By using our site, you You can then call the Substring method to extract the substring that you want. In other words, find all substrings of the first string that are anagrams of the second string. generate link and share the link here. Substring is the part of any string or substring is nothing but a subset of a string. In this guide, you will learn different ways to get a PowerShell substring from a PowerShell string. A program that will get an input string and provide the possible unique substrings of that string. To find all substrings of a string, use a nested loop, where one of the loop traverses from one end of the string other, while the other loop changes the length of substring. The substring method of String class is used to find a substring. ac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Python | All occurrences of substring in string, Python program to find number of days between two given dates, Python | Difference between two dates (in minutes) using datetime.timedelta() method, Python | Convert string to DateTime and vice-versa, Convert the column type from string to datetime format in Pandas dataframe, Adding new column to existing DataFrame in Pandas, Create a new column in Pandas DataFrame based on the existing columns, Python | Creating a Pandas dataframe column based on a given condition, Selecting rows in pandas DataFrame based on conditions, Get all rows in a Pandas DataFrame containing given substring, Python | Find position of a character in given string, replace() in Python to replace a substring, Python | Replace substring in list of strings, Python – Replace Substrings from String List, Python program to convert a list to string, How to get column names in Pandas dataframe, Reading and Writing to text files in Python, isupper(), islower(), lower(), upper() in Python and their applications, Python | Program to convert String to a List, Python | Split string into list of characters, Python program to check whether a number is Prime or not, Write Interview For each character in the given string, we … Let’s discuss certain ways in which this problem can be solved. In this method, we first calculate all the possible substring by using nested for loops. For instance, "the best of" is a substring of "It was the best of times". For example substrings of “cat” are :- “c”, “ca”, “cat”, “a”, “at” and “t”. For each substring call eraseAllSubStr() to // remove its all occurrences from main string. You can create a PowerShell substring from a string using either the substring, split methods. Note: All the possible substrings for a string will be n*(n + 1)/2. Find all substrings of a string that contains all characters of another string. The easiest way to replace all occurrences of a given substring in a string is to use the replace () function. Finding Unique Substrings of a Given String in C#: The substring method of String class is used to find a substring. Method #2 : Using itertools.combinations() So, here we are creating the string array with the size n*(n+1)/2. brightness_4 An example of a string is subdomain.domain.com. Also, aba is yet another substring occurring thrice in the string. Check if a string is a substring If you aren't interested in all of the substrings in a string, you might prefer to work with one of the string comparison methods that returns the index at which the match begins. A Substring in C# is a contiguous sequence of characters within a string. By using our site, you Method #1 : Using list comprehension + string slicing With the help of this function, you can retrieve any number of substrings from a single string. Substring is a set of a continuous sequence of characters within a string. Here is a list of commonly asked questions related to C# substring with code examples. The innermost loop prints characters from currently picked starting point to picked ending point. The substrings of subdomain.domain.comare subdomain, domain, or com. Loop through the length of the string and use the Substring function from the beginning to the end of the string − for (int start = 0; start <= str.Length - i; start++) { string substr = str.Substring(start, i); Console.WriteLine(substr); } This method is used to return or extract the substring from the main String. As we have two loops and also String’s substring method has a time complexity of o(n) If you want to find all distinct substrings of String,then use HashSet to remove duplicates. A substring is a part of a string. Check if all substrings of length K of a Binary String has equal count of 0s and 1s. Introduction. package main import ( "fmt" "strings" ) func main() { s := "Hello!World" fmt.Println(strings.Split(s, "!")) After that count all the substring that we calculated. Strengthen your foundations with the Python Programming Foundation Course and learn the basics. If you like GeeksforGeeks and would like to contribute, you can also write an article using contribute.geeksforgeeks.org or mail your article to contribute@geeksforgeeks.org. The complete syntax is as follows: object[start:stop:step] Where: object is the source string (can be any sequence like list etc.) acknowledge that you have read and understood our, GATE CS Original Papers and Official Keys, ISRO CS Original Papers and Official Keys, ISRO CS Syllabus for Scientist/Engineer Exam, Amazon Interview Experience for SDE-1 (Full Time-Referral) 2020, Count of substrings of length K with exactly K distinct characters, Count number of substrings with exactly k distinct characters, Number of substrings with count of each character as k, String with k distinct characters and no same characters adjacent, Print all subsequences of a string | Iterative Method, Print all subsequences of a string using ArrayList, Generating all possible Subsequences using Recursion, Subarray/Substring vs Subsequence and Programs to Generate them, Find subarray with given sum | Set 1 (Nonnegative Numbers), Find subarray with given sum | Set 2 (Handles Negative Numbers), Find subarray with given sum with negatives allowed in constant space, Smallest subarray with sum greater than a given value, Find maximum average subarray of k length, Count minimum steps to get the given desired array, Number of subsets with product less than k, Find minimum number of merge operations to make an array palindrome, Find the smallest positive integer value that cannot be represented as sum of any subset of a given array, https://www.geeksforgeeks.org/java-lang-string-substring-java/, Python program to check if a string is palindrome or not, Write a program to reverse an array or string, Write Interview Method 2 (Using substr() function) s.substr(i, len) prints substring of length ‘len’ starting from index i in string s. This method is contributed by Ravi Shankar Rai, Method 3 (Generate a substring using previous substring). There are two types of substring methods in java string. Further, if you observe it is not maintaining the uniqueness of the strings. In other words, a substring in C# is a portion of a string. The string class in C# represents a string. Using LINQ to Find All and Unique Substrings of a Given String in C#: In the following example, we show you how to use LINQ query to find all the possible substrings as well as unique strings of a given string. Don’t stop learning now. edit For example, In a String “Software Testing”, the “Software” and “Testing” are the substrings.. close, link A program that will get an input string and provide the possible unique substrings of that string. For example, "Itwastimes" is a subsequence of "It was the best of times", but not a substring. Get hold of all the important DSA concepts with the DSA Self Paced Course at a student-friendly price and become industry ready. edit Please use ide.geeksforgeeks.org, This particular utility is very popular in competitive programming and having shorthands to solve this problem can always be handy. SUBSTRING in SQL is a function used to retrieve characters from a string. For a string of length n, there are (n(n+1))/2 non-empty substrings and an empty string. code, The original string is : Geeks Ususally when a programmer goes to the interview, the company asks to write the code of some program to check your logic and coding abilities. Every subset or portion of an original string is called a Sub string. The string comparison methods include: String.IndexOf and String.Substring methods. Writing code in comment? Let’s say our string is − Xyz. See your article appearing on the GeeksforGeeks main page and help other Geeks.Please write comments if you find anything incorrect, or you want to share more information about the topic discussed above. A substring is itself a string that is part of a longer string. /* * Erase all Occurrences of all given substrings from main string using C++11 stuff */ void eraseSubStrings(std::string & mainStr, const std::vector & strList) { // Iterate over the given list of substrings. String.IndexOf and String.Substring methods. Ususally when a programmer goes to the interview, the company asks to write the code of some program to check your logic and coding abilities. substring method of String class is used to find substring. In formal language theory and computer science, a substring is a contiguous sequence of characters within a string. Let’s see the different methods to do it, Find & Replace all sub strings – using STL This method is used to return or extract the substring from the main String. As you can see in the above output, it prints all the possible substrings of a given string. This particular task can also be performed using the inbuilt function of combinations, which helps to get all the possible combinations i.e the substrings from a string. Java substring() As we all know, Java substring is nothing but a part of the main String. “Boost Library is simple C++ Library” And we want replace all occurrences of ‘Lib’ with XXX. Permuting letters within three-letter substrings of strings over $\{\mathsf{x},\mathsf{y},\mathsf{z}\}$ to yield a target “cyclic string” 1 The numbers of strings … For each substring call eraseAllSubStr() to // remove its all occurrences from main string. A substring, as the name implies, is a contiguous sequence of characters within a string! Find substrings of a string in Java The java string substring () method returns a part of the string. Writing code in comment? You are given a string s and an array of strings words of the same length.Return all starting indices of substring(s) in s that is a concatenation of each word in words exactly once, in any order, and without any intervening characters.. You can return the answer in any order.. In other words, start index starts from 0 whereas end index starts from 1. Attention geek! For a string of length n, there are (n (n+1))/2 non-empty substrings and an empty string. Start – the character where you want to get a substring … The idea is inspired from … If all you need to do is get a boolean value indicating if the substring is in another string, then this is what you'll want to use. We can solve this problem in O (n2) time and O (1) space. How to convert string to palindrome, provided substring should exist in palindrome string ? Regular expressions can also be used to split a string in Go. Experience. In this tutorial, we shall write Java programs to find all possible substrings of a string, and also to find all unique substrings of a string. If needed, the standard library's re module provides a more diverse toolset that can be used for more niche problems like finding patterns and case-insensitive searches. The string comparison methods include: Please go through Frequently asked java interview Programs for more such programs. You can then call the Substring method to extract the substring that you want. An empty or NULL string is considered to be a substring of every string. Please use ide.geeksforgeeks.org, You are given a string s and an array of strings words of the same length.Return all starting indices of substring(s) in s that is a concatenation of each word in words exactly once, in any order, and without any intervening characters.. You can return the answer in any order.. Example 1: Input: s = "barfoothefoobarman", words = ["foo","bar"] Output: [0,9] Explanation: Substrings … This article will cover in-depth about string in PowerShell, various functions that are available related to string operations, substrings, functions related to substring. Now, the catch in the question is for strings like “ababc”. substr = a_string[4:17] So, you have to specify the start and end position of the source string to get the substring. Use the substring() method in C# to find all substrings in a string. Find the starting indices of the substrings in string (S) which is made by concatenating all words from a list(L) 31, Dec 17. /* * Erase all Occurrences of all given substrings from main string using C++11 stuff */ void eraseSubStrings(std::string & mainStr, const std::vector & strList) { // Iterate over the given list of substrings. You can create a PowerShell substring from a string using either the substring, split methods.An example of a string is subdomain.domain.com.The substrings of subdomain.domain.com are subdomain, domain, or com.. Java code to print substrings of a string is given below.… Read More » Program to print all substrings of a given string, Generate a string whose all K-size substrings can be concatenated to form the given string, Lexicographically smallest permutation of a string that contains all substrings of another string, Count the number of vowels occurring in all the substrings of given string, Lexicographically all Shortest Palindromic Substrings from a given string, Count of substrings of a given Binary string with all characters same, Minimum shifts of substrings of 1s required to group all 1s together in a given Binary string, Print Kth character in sorted concatenated substrings of a string, Count of substrings of a string containing another given string as a substring | Set 2, Count of substrings of a string containing another given string as a substring, Minimum number of substrings the given string can be splitted into that satisfy the given conditions, Reverse the substrings of the given String according to the given Array of indices, Sum of all substrings of a string representing a number | Set 2 (Constant Extra Space), Find the starting indices of the substrings in string (S) which is made by concatenating all words from a list(L), Check if all substrings of length K of a Binary String has equal count of 0s and 1s, Lexicographic rank of a string among all its substrings, Lexicographical concatenation of all substrings of a string, Minimum changes to a string to make all substrings distinct, Sum of all substrings of a string representing a number | Set 1, Count unique substrings of a string S present in a wraparound string, Write a program to print all permutations of a given string, Different substrings in a string that start and end with given strings, Permutation of given string that maximizes count of Palindromic substrings, Repeat substrings of the given String required number of times, Queries to find the count of vowels in the substrings of the given string, Data Structures and Algorithms – Self Paced Course, Ad-Free Experience – GeeksforGeeks Premium, We use cookies to ensure you have the best browsing experience on our website.
Trip Meaning In Urdu, Poop Color Wheel, Nickent 3dx Pro Irons, Can Cats Eat Tofu, Hells Angels Chapters, Neo Geo Dreamcast, Costco Wholesale Delivery, Relearning Psychology Meme, How Old Is Kimmy From Fuller House,

all substrings of a string 2021